Ingredients
-
1 lb (450g) large shrimp, peeled and deveined
-
2 tablespoons olive oil
-
4 cloves garlic, minced
-
1/4 cup honey
-
2 tablespoons soy sauce
-
1 tablespoon rice vinegar (or apple cider vinegar)
-
1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ional)
-
Salt and pepper, to taste
-
Chopped green onions and sesame seeds (for garnish)
Instructions
Prepare Sauce:
In a small bowl, whisk together honey, soy sauce, rice vinegar, and red pepper flakes.
Cook Shrimp:
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add shrimp, season with salt and pepper, and cook for 2 minutes on each side until pink and opaque. Remove shrimp from skillet and set aside.
Sauté Garlic:
In the same skillet, add minced garlic and cook for about 30 seconds until fragrant.
Add Sauce:
Pour the honey garlic sauce into the skillet. Bring to a simmer and cook for 1–2 minutes until sauce thickens slightly.
Combine:
Return shrimp to the skillet and toss to coat evenly with the sauce. Cook for another minute to heat through.
Serve:
Garnish with chopped green onions and sesame seeds. Serve over rice or noodles.
